The original Colonial Farmstead was constructed sometime around the turn of the 18th century and was renovated and revamped in 1988, when the exquisite accommodation suites were constructed. In 1991 Highgrove House opened its door as a five-star country hotel. The renovations have retained the character of the era whilst ensuring that today's guests luxuriate in modern comforts, with total privacy and personal service.
Aged Jacaranda trees provide an enchanting entrance avenue. Fine collection of antiques and Persian carpets adorns the reception rooms, warmed by crackling wood fires when winters chill sets in.
Mrs Kathy Russell attained the beautiful property in 2007 after spending one night. She fell in love with the avenue of Jacaranda trees, the surrounding forests married to the English Colonial ambience and great cuisine. Her eye for detail and her passion for beautiful things has translated into what is the elegance, style and magnificence of Highgrove House.
